USC信息科学研究所(ISI)的研究负责人和USC维特比工程学院的计算机科学研究助理教授Jonathan May正在与ISI程序员分析师兼前途的USC Viterbi博士Justin Cho探讨这个问题。学生,通过他们的精选对可学习即兴创作(SPOLIN)项目。他们的研究将即兴对话纳入聊天机器人,以产生更具吸引力的互动。
SPOLIN研究资料库由68,000多个英语对话对,或对对话做出迅速反应和随后的回应所组成。这些对以“是”和“对话”为模型,这是即兴创作的基本原则,鼓励进行更多有基础和相关的对话。收集数据后,Cho和May建造了SpolinBot,这是一个即席即用的代理程序,该程序使用第一个yes-and research集合编程,该集合足以训练聊天机器人。
7月6日,在7月5日至10日举行的计算语言协会会议上,发表了项目研究论文“即兴对话与即兴对话”。
梅正在他的工作中寻找新的研究思路。他对语言分析的热爱使他从事自然语言处理(NLP)项目的工作,并且他开始寻找可以使用的更有趣的数据形式。
他说:“我在大学里做了一些即兴创作,并一直呆在那些日子里。”“然后,一个在我大学即兴表演团里的朋友建议,有一个‘是-’机器人可以和它一起练习,这很方便,这给了我灵感-制作一个可以即兴创作,这很实用!”
May对这个想法的探索越深入,他发现这个想法就越有效。是-并且是即兴创作的支柱,它促使参与者接受另一位参与者所说的现实(“是”),然后通过提供其他信息(“和”)在该现实之上建立。该技术是在互动中建立共同基础的关键。如May所言,“是的,并且是即兴社区所说的“接地”的方式。”
是的,并且很重要,因为它们可以帮助参与者共同建立一个现实。例如,在电影脚本中,可能有10-11%的行被视为是和,而在即兴创作中,至少有25%的行被视为是。这是因为,与电影已经为观众确定的设置和角色不同,即兴创作者的表演没有场景,道具或任何客观现实。
乔说:“由于即兴表演场景几乎没有既定现实,所以在即兴表演中进行对话会积极尝试达成共同的假设和谅解。”“这使即兴对话比大多数普通对话更有趣,后者通常是根据已经存在的许多假设(根据常识,视觉信号等)进行的。”
但是,找到从中提取即兴对话的来源是一个挑战。最初,May和Cho检查了典型的对话集,例如电影剧本和字幕集,但这些消息来源所含的Yes-ands不够多。而且,可能很难找到已记录的,更不用说转录的即兴创作了。
在2018年秋季以交换生的身份访问南加州大学之前,Cho与May进行了接触,询问他可以参加的NLP研究项目。Cho来到USC之后,他了解了May的即兴项目。
乔说:“我对它如何触及我不熟悉的利基很感兴趣,我特别感兴趣的是,在这方面几乎没有或没有以前的工作。”“当乔恩说我们的项目将回答一个尚未被问到的问题时,我感到很困惑:这个问题是如何通过“是和行动”即兴进行建模的基础如何有助于改善对话系统。”
Cho研究了多种收集即兴数据的方法。他最终遇到了Spontaneanation,这是由多产演员和喜剧演员Paul F. Tompkins主持的即兴播客,播客时间为2015年至2019年。
凭借其开放式专题节目,大约30分钟的持续即兴创作,高质量的录音以及相当大的规模,Spontaneanation是为该项目挖掘是与否的理想来源。二人将其自发化数据输入程序,SpolinBot诞生了。
梅解释说:“该项目的一个很酷的部分是我们找到了一种即兴使用的方法。”“自发化对我们来说是一个很好的资源,但是随着数据集的发展,它是很小的;从中我们只能得到大约10,000个肯定的答案。但是,我们使用那些肯定的答案来构建一个分类器(程序),可以查看对话并确定它们是否为“是”。
首先,与即兴对话进行合作有助于研究人员从其他来源中找到是和否,因为大多数SPOLIN数据都来自电影脚本和字幕。梅说:“最终,SPOLIN语料库包含的yes和非即兴来源的数量是即兴创作的五倍,但我们只能从即兴开始获得这些yes。”
SpolinBot有一些控件可以优化其响应,使它们从安全无聊到有趣和古怪,还可以生成五个响应选项,用户可以从中选择以继续对话。
这对二人为SpolinBot制定了许多计划,并将其对话能力扩展到“是”之外。“我们想探索其他使即兴创作变得有趣的因素,例如角色塑造,场景塑造,‘如果这(通常是一个有趣的异常)是真的,还有什么是真的?’和回叫(指的是对象) /上次对话中提到的事件),” Cho说。“我们还有很长的路要走,这让我为我在整个博士学位期间以及以后所能探索的一切感到更加兴奋。”
可能会与Cho的观点相呼应。他说:“最终,我们希望建立一个良好的对话伙伴和良好的创造力伙伴。”他指出,即使是即兴创作,是的,也只是对话的开始。“当今的机器人(包括SpolinBot)并不能很好地保持对话的进行。应该有一种感觉,两个参与者不仅在建立一个现实,而且还在一起体验这个现实。”
后一点很关键,因为正如梅所解释的那样,好的伙伴应该像Alexa和Siri一样平等,不能屈服。他说:“我希望我的伴侣与我一起做出决定并集思广益。”“我们最终应该能够从人类长期合作中受益于团队合作和合作中获得收益。虚拟伙伴的另一个好处是,与我相比,数学水平更高,更快,并且实际上不需要吃饭! ”
-
聊天机器人
+关注
关注
0文章
332浏览量
12295 -
自然语言处理
+关注
关注
1文章
614浏览量
13511 -
nlp
+关注
关注
1文章
487浏览量
22015
发布评论请先 登录
相关推荐
评论